Tutustu PDF-generaatiokirjastojen maailmaan rintamerkkien tulostukseen. Opit valitsemaan oikean kirjaston tarpeisiisi ja parantamaan osallistujien kokemusta.
Rintamerkkien tulostus: Opas PDF-generaatiokirjastoihin globaaleihin tapahtumiin
Globaalien tapahtumien dynaamisessa maisemassa, suurista konferensseista Berliinissä intiimeihin työpajoihin Tokiossa, henkilökohtaiset osallistujamerkit ovat välttämättömiä. Ne helpottavat verkostoitumista, parantavat turvallisuutta ja edistävät myönteistä yleistä kokemusta. Tehokkaan rintamerkkien luomisen keskiössä on vankkojen PDF-generaatiokirjastojen käyttö. Tämä kattava opas tutkii PDF-generaatiokirjastojen maailmaa erityisesti rintamerkkien tulostukseen, ja tarjoaa tapahtumajärjestäjille maailmanlaajuisesti näkemyksiä parhaan työkalun valitsemiseen tarpeisiinsa.
Miksi PDF-generaatiokirjastot ovat ratkaisevan tärkeitä rintamerkkien tulostukselle
Rintamerkkien luominen manuaalisesti on epäkäytännöllistä, erityisesti tapahtumissa, joissa on satoja tai tuhansia osallistujia. PDF-generaatiokirjastot automatisoivat prosessin ja tarjoavat useita keskeisiä etuja:
- Skaalautuvuus: Käsittele minkä tahansa kokoisia tapahtumia, pienistä kokoontumisista massiivisiin kansainvälisiin konferensseihin.
- Automaatio: Virtaviivaista rintamerkkien luomista integroimalla rekisteröintijärjestelmiin ja tietokantoihin.
- Mukauttaminen: Suunnittele rintamerkit ainutlaatuisilla asetteluilla, logoilla, osallistujatiedoilla ja jopa QR-koodeilla tai viivakoodeilla.
- Tehokkuus: Vähennä tulostusvirheitä ja säästä arvokasta aikaa ja resursseja.
- Yhtenäisyys: Varmista yhtenäinen ja ammattimainen ulkonäkö kaikissa rintamerkeissä.
- Integrointi: Integroi saumattomasti olemassa oleviin tapahtumahallinta-alustoihin.
Tärkeimmät huomioon otettavat asiat PDF-generaatiokirjastoa valittaessa
Oikean PDF-generaatiokirjaston valitseminen on ratkaisevan tärkeää sujuvan ja tehokkaan rintamerkkien tulostustyönkulun kannalta. Ota huomioon seuraavat tekijät:
1. Ohjelmointikielen yhteensopivuus
Valitse kirjasto, joka on yhteensopiva suosikkiohjelmointikielesi kanssa (esim. Java, Python, PHP, .NET, JavaScript). Harkitse kieliä, joita olemassa olevat tapahtumahallintajärjestelmäsi käyttävät. Esimerkiksi, jos järjestelmäsi on rakennettu Pythonilla, ReportLabin kaltainen kirjasto on luonteva valinta. .NET-ympäristöissä harkitse kirjastoja, kuten iTextSharp (tai sen seuraaja iText 7) tai PDFSharp.
Esimerkki: Monikansallinen yhtiö standardoi Javaa sisäisille työkaluilleen. Vuotuisessa globaalissa konferenssissaan he valitsisivat todennäköisesti Java-pohjaisen PDF-kirjaston, kuten iText, varmistaakseen saumattoman integroinnin.
2. Lisensointi ja kustannukset
Ymmärrä kirjaston lisensointiehdot. Jotkut kirjastot ovat avoimen lähdekoodin (esim. ReportLab), kun taas toiset vaativat kaupallisia lisenssejä (esim. iText, Aspose.PDF). Harkitse budjettiasi ja tarvitsemiasi ominaisuuksia. Avoimen lähdekoodin kirjastot tarjoavat usein yhteisötukea, kun taas kaupalliset kirjastot tarjoavat omistettua tukea ja kehittyneempiä ominaisuuksia.
Esimerkki: Pieni voittoa tavoittelematon järjestö, joka järjestää ilmaisen yhteisötapahtuman, saattaa valita avoimen lähdekoodin ReportLabin kustannusten minimoimiseksi, kun taas suuri yritys, joka käsittelee luottamuksellisia tietoja, investoi maksulliseen kirjastoon, kuten iText, edistyneiden turvallisuusvaihtoehtojen ja virallisen tuen vuoksi.
3. Ominaisuudet ja toiminnallisuus
Arvioi kirjaston ominaisuudet varmistaaksesi, että se vastaa rintamerkkien tulostuksen erityistarpeitasi. Tärkeimmät huomioon otettavat ominaisuudet ovat:
- Tekstin muotoilu: Tuki eri fonteille, kokoille, tyyleille ja merkistökoodaukselle (olennaista monikielisille tapahtumille).
- Kuvien käsittely: Kyky lisätä logoja, osallistujien valokuvia ja muita grafiikoita.
- Viivakoodi-/QR-koodin luominen: Erilaisten viivakoodi- ja QR-koodityyppien luominen osallistujien seurantaa ja pääsynvalvontaa varten.
- Taulukoiden luominen: Kyky luoda taulukoita osallistujatietojen näyttämistä varten.
- Mallipohjan tuki: Kyky käyttää valmiiksi suunniteltuja rintamerkkimalleja yhtenäisen brändäyksen varmistamiseksi.
- PDF-standardien noudattaminen: PDF-standardien noudattaminen saavutettavuuden ja yhteensopivuuden varmistamiseksi.
- Unicode-tuki: Olennaista eri puolilta maailmaa tulevien nimien ja osoitteiden käsittelyyn.
Esimerkki: Kiinassa järjestettävä tapahtuma vaatisi kirjaston, joka tukee täysin kiinalaisia merkistöjä (Unicode) ja fonttien renderöintiä. Sveitsissä järjestettävä konferenssi voi tarvita tukea useille kielille, mukaan lukien saksa, ranska, italia ja retoromaani, samassa rintamerkissä.
4. Helppokäyttöisyys ja dokumentaatio
Valitse kirjasto, jolla on selkeä dokumentaatio ja käyttäjäystävällinen API. Hyvin dokumentoitu kirjasto yksinkertaistaa kehitystä ja lyhentää oppimiskäyrää. Etsi kattavia esimerkkejä ja opetusohjelmia.
Esimerkki: Tiimi, jolla on rajallinen ohjelmointikokemus, saattaa suosia kirjastoa, jolla on laaja dokumentaatio ja helposti saatavilla olevia koodinäytteitä, kuten jsPDF JavaScriptille.
5. Suorituskyky ja skaalautuvuus
Harkitse kirjaston suorituskykyä, varsinkin jos sinun on luotava suuri määrä rintamerkkejä nopeasti. Jotkut kirjastot ovat tehokkaampia kuin toiset, erityisesti monimutkaisten asettelujen tai korkean resoluution kuvien kanssa.
Esimerkki: 10 000 osallistujan konferenssi tarvitsee kirjaston, joka voi luoda rintamerkkejä nopeasti välttääkseen viivästykset rekisteröinnin aikana. Suorituskyvyn vertailu eri kirjastojen välillä on suositeltavaa.
6. Yhteisötuki ja päivitykset
Tarkista kirjaston yhteisön koko ja aktiivisuus. Suuri ja aktiivinen yhteisö osoittaa hyvää tukea ja jatkuvaa kehitystä. Säännölliset päivitykset ja virhekorjaukset ovat välttämättömiä turvallisuuden ja vakauden kannalta.
Esimerkki: Kirjastoilla, kuten iText ja ReportLab, on suuria, aktiivisia yhteisöjä, jotka tarjoavat tukea foorumien, postituslistojen ja verkkoresurssien kautta.
7. Turvallisuusominaisuudet
Tapahtumissa, joissa käsitellään arkaluonteisia tietoja, priorisoi kirjastot, joilla on vankat turvallisuusominaisuudet, kuten salasanasuojaus ja salaus. Harkitse kirjastoja, jotka noudattavat asiaankuuluvia turvallisuusstandardeja (esim. GDPR, HIPAA).
Esimerkki: Lääketieteellinen konferenssi, joka käsittelee osallistujien tietoja, tarvitsee kirjaston, joka tarjoaa vahvat salausominaisuudet arkaluonteisten tietojen suojaamiseksi.
Suosittuja PDF-generaatiokirjastoja rintamerkkien tulostukseen
Tässä on joitain suosituimpia PDF-generaatiokirjastoja, joita käytetään rintamerkkien tulostukseen:
1. iText (Java, .NET)
Kuvaus: iText on tehokas ja monipuolinen PDF-kirjasto Javalle ja .NET:lle. Se tarjoaa laajan valikoiman ominaisuuksia, mukaan lukien tekstin muotoilu, kuvien käsittely, viivakoodien luominen ja digitaaliset allekirjoitukset. Se on kaupallinen kirjasto, jolla on avoimen lähdekoodin vaihtoehtoja AGPL-lisenssillä.
Plussat:
- Kattava ominaisuusjoukko
- Erinomainen dokumentaatio ja tuki
- Kaupallinen tuki saatavilla
- Kypsä ja vakaa
Miinukset:
- Kaupallinen lisenssi vaaditaan useimmissa käyttötapauksissa
- Voi olla monimutkainen oppia
Käyttötapaukset: Suuret yritykset, organisaatiot, jotka vaativat edistyneitä PDF-ominaisuuksia ja kaupallista tukea, vaatimustenmukaisuutta painottavat toimialat, kuten rahoitus ja terveydenhuolto.
2. ReportLab (Python)
Kuvaus: ReportLab on avoimen lähdekoodin PDF-kirjasto Pythonille. Se tarjoaa joustavan ja mukautettavan kehyksen PDF-tiedostojen luomiseen. Se sopii hyvin raporttien, laskujen ja rintamerkkien luomiseen.
Plussat:
- Avoimen lähdekoodin ja vapaasti käytettävissä
- Joustava ja mukautettava
- Hyvä dokumentaatio ja esimerkit
- Sopii hyvin dataan perustuvaan PDF-generaatioon
Miinukset:
- Voi olla vähemmän tehokas kuin kaupalliset kirjastot
- Rajoitettu kaupallinen tuki
Käyttötapaukset: Startupit, pienet yritykset, oppilaitokset, projektit, joissa kustannukset ovat suuri tekijä ja laajaa kaupallista tukea ei vaadita.
3. PDFSharp (C#)
Kuvaus: PDFsharp on .NET-kirjasto PDF-dokumenttien luomiseen ja muokkaamiseen. Se tukee useita ominaisuuksia, mukaan lukien tekstin muotoilu, kuvien käsittely ja sivuasettelu. Se on avoimen lähdekoodin kirjasto.
Plussat:
- Täysin kirjoitettu C#:lla.
- Luo PDF-dokumentteja tyhjästä.
- Muokkaa olemassa olevia PDF-dokumentteja.
- Pura tekstiä ja kuvia PDF-dokumenteista.
- Avoimen lähdekoodin.
Miinukset:
- Vähemmän kattavat ominaisuudet kuin iText.
- Ei aktiivisesti kehitetty.
Käyttötapaukset: .NET-kehittäjät, jotka haluavat helppokäyttöisen ja kevyen PDF-kirjaston. Sopii yksinkertaisempiin rintamerkkien asetteluihin.
4. jsPDF (JavaScript)
Kuvaus: jsPDF on JavaScript-kirjasto PDF-tiedostojen luomiseen selaimessa. Se on kevyt ja helppokäyttöinen, mikä tekee siitä sopivan rintamerkkien luomiseen asiakaspuolella. Se on avoimen lähdekoodin kirjasto.
Plussat:
- Kevyt ja helppokäyttöinen
- Asiakaspuolen PDF-generaatio
- Avoimen lähdekoodin ja vapaasti käytettävissä
Miinukset:
- Rajoitettu ominaisuusjoukko verrattuna palvelinpuolen kirjastoihin
- Suorituskykyrajoitukset monimutkaisille PDF-tiedostoille
Käyttötapaukset: Yksinkertaiset rintamerkkien asettelut, asiakaspuolen PDF-generaatio, prototyyppien tekeminen, tilanteet, joissa palvelinpuolen käsittely ei ole mahdollista.
5. TCPDF (PHP)
Kuvaus: TCPDF on ilmainen ja avoimen lähdekoodin PHP-luokka PDF-dokumenttien luomiseen. TCPDF tukee UTF-8:aa, Unicodea, RTL-kieliä ja useita viivakoodiformaatteja. Sitä käytetään laajalti raporttien, laskujen ja rintamerkkien luomiseen PHP-sovelluksissa.
Plussat:
- Ilmainen ja avoimen lähdekoodin.
- Tukee UTF-8:aa ja Unicodea.
- Tukee RTL-kieliä.
- Luo erilaisia viivakoodiformaatteja.
Miinukset:
- Voi olla monimutkainen konfiguroida.
- Dokumentaatiota voidaan parantaa.
Käyttötapaukset: PHP-pohjaiset tapahtumahallintajärjestelmät tai web-sovellukset, jotka vaativat dynaamisesti luotuja rintamerkkejä.
6. Aspose.PDF (Java, .NET)
Kuvaus: Aspose.PDF on kaupallinen PDF-kirjasto, joka tukee useita alustoja, mukaan lukien Java ja .NET. Se tarjoaa laajan valikoiman ominaisuuksia, mukaan lukien PDF:n luominen, manipulointi ja muuntaminen. Se tunnetaan kattavasta ominaisuusjoukosta ja vahvasta suorituskyvystä.
Plussat:
- Laaja valikoima ominaisuuksia
- Hyvä suorituskyky
- Kaupallinen tuki saatavilla
Miinukset:
- Kaupallinen lisenssi vaaditaan
- Voi olla kallis pienille projekteille
Käyttötapaukset: Suuret yritykset, organisaatiot, jotka vaativat edistyneitä PDF-ominaisuuksia, projektit, joissa suorituskyky on kriittinen.
Rintamerkkien tulostuksen toteuttaminen PDF-generaatiokirjastolla: Vaiheittainen opas
Tässä on yleinen hahmotelma vaiheista, jotka liittyvät rintamerkkien tulostamiseen PDF-generaatiokirjastolla:
- Valitse PDF-generaatiokirjasto: Valitse kirjasto ohjelmointikielesi, lisensointivaatimusten, ominaisuuksien ja suorituskykyvaatimusten perusteella.
- Asenna kirjasto: Asenna kirjasto kehitysympäristöösi dokumentaation mukaisesti.
- Suunnittele rintamerkin asettelu: Luo malli tai suunnittele rintamerkin asettelu kirjaston API:n avulla. Harkitse visuaalisen suunnittelutyökalun käyttöä mallin luomiseksi.
- Yhdistä tietolähteeseen: Yhdistä tapahtuman rekisteröintijärjestelmään tai tietokantaan osallistujatietojen noutamiseksi.
- Täytä rintamerkki tiedoilla: Käytä kirjaston API:a täyttääksesi rintamerkkimalli osallistujatiedoilla, kuten nimi, titteli, organisaatio ja QR-koodi.
- Luo PDF: Luo PDF-dokumentti kirjaston funktioiden avulla.
- Tulosta rintamerkit: Lähetä PDF-dokumentti tulostimelle rintamerkkien tulostamiseksi.
- Testaa ja viimeistele: Testaa rintamerkkien tulostusprosessi perusteellisesti ja viimeistele asettelu ja tietojen kartoitus tarpeen mukaan.
Esimerkki: Käyttämällä Pythonia ja ReportLabia, asentaisit ensin kirjaston (`pip install reportlab`). Sitten määrität kankaan ja käytät ReportLabin piirtofunktioita tekstin, kuvien ja viivakoodien sijoittamiseen rintamerkkiin. Lopuksi tallennat kankaan PDF-tiedostona.
Parhaat käytännöt rintamerkkien tulostukseen
Varmistaaksesi sujuvan ja onnistuneen rintamerkkien tulostusprosessin, noudata näitä parhaita käytäntöjä:
- Käytä korkealaatuisia materiaaleja: Käytä korkealaatuisia rintamerkkipohjia ja tulostimen nauhoja kestävien ja ammattimaisen näköisten rintamerkkien luomiseksi.
- Optimoi rintamerkkien suunnittelu: Suunnittele rintamerkit, jotka ovat helppolukuisia ja visuaalisesti houkuttelevia. Käytä selkeitä fontteja ja kontrastivärejä.
- Sisällytä olennaiset tiedot: Sisällytä vain olennaiset tiedot rintamerkkiin, kuten nimi, titteli ja organisaatio. Vältä sotkemasta rintamerkkiä tarpeettomilla yksityiskohdilla.
- Käytä viivakoodeja tai QR-koodeja: Käytä viivakoodeja tai QR-koodeja tehokkaaseen osallistujien seurantaan ja pääsynvalvontaan.
- Testaa tulostus perusteellisesti: Testaa rintamerkkien tulostusprosessi perusteellisesti ennen tapahtumaa ongelmien tunnistamiseksi ja ratkaisemiseksi.
- Anna selkeät ohjeet: Anna osallistujille selkeät ohjeet rintamerkkien pukemisesta ja käytöstä.
- Tietosuoja ja turvallisuus: Noudata kaikkia asiaankuuluvia tietosuojasäännöksiä kerätessäsi ja näyttäessäsi osallistujatietoja.
- Harkitse saavutettavuutta: Varmista, että rintamerkit ovat vammaisten osallistujien saatavilla, esimerkiksi käyttämällä suuria fontteja ja suurta kontrastia.
- Suunnittele rintamerkkien tulostaminen paikan päällä: Ole valmis tulostamaan rintamerkkejä paikan päällä myöhäisille rekisteröityneille tai osallistujille, jotka kadottavat rintamerkkinsä.
Johtopäätös
Oikean PDF-generaatiokirjaston valitseminen on kriittinen askel rintamerkkien tulostuksen virtaviivaistamisessa globaaleissa tapahtumissa. Harkitsemalla huolellisesti ohjelmointikielesi, lisensointivaatimukset, ominaisuudet ja suorituskykyvaatimukset, voit valita kirjaston, joka vastaa erityisvaatimuksiasi ja parantaa osallistujien kokemusta. Avoimen lähdekoodin vaihtoehdoista, kuten ReportLab ja jsPDF, kaupallisiin ratkaisuihin, kuten iText ja Aspose.PDF, on saatavilla laaja valikoima kirjastoja, jotka palvelevat erilaisia tarpeita ja budjetteja. Rintamerkkien tulostuksen parhaiden käytäntöjen, kuten korkealaatuisten materiaalien käytön ja rintamerkkien suunnittelun optimoinnin, toteuttaminen edistää edelleen onnistunutta ja ammattimaista tapahtumaa.
Lopulta tehokas rintamerkkien tulostus on enemmän kuin vain PDF-tiedostojen luomista. Se on kutsuvan ja tehokkaan ympäristön luomista osallistujillesi, verkostoitumisen helpottamista ja tapahtumasi sujuvan toiminnan varmistamista riippumatta siitä, missä päin maailmaa se järjestetään.